Original Description
Youth at the Prow, Pleasure at the Helm (1832) by William Etty is a masterful allegorical painting that embodies the Romantic era’s fascination with beauty, sensuality, and moral symbolism. The luminous tableau depicts two ethereal figures—Youth, standing boldly at the prow of a golden boat, and Pleasure, a voluptuous nude reclining at the helm—guided by a pair of winged cherubs across a shimmering sea. Bathed in warm, golden light against a dreamlike sky, the scene exudes both vitality and indulgence, blurring the line between virtue and hedonism. Etty, renowned for his virtuoso handling of flesh tones and dynamic compositions, drew inspiration from Renaissance masters like Titian while infusing the work with a distinctly 19th-century theatricality. Though controversial in its time for its unabashed celebration of the nude, the painting cemented Etty’s reputation as a pioneer of British history painting and a bridge between classical ideals and Victorian aesthetics. Today, it remains a celebrated example of how Romanticism entwined emotion with allegory.
